What Causes Stomach Ulcers?

Stomach ulcers, medically termed peptic ulcers, are open sores that develop on the lining of the stomach. They can also occur in the upper part of the small intestine, known as the duodenum. While various factors can contribute to their development, two primary culprits stand out: infection with the bacterium Helicobacter pylori (H. pylori) and the prolonged use of nonsteroidal anti-inflammatory drugs (NSAIDs).

The Role of Helicobacter pylori (H. pylori)

Helicobacter pylori is a common bacterium that infects the stomach lining. It is estimated that a significant majority of peptic ulcers are linked to this infection. H. pylori can survive in the harsh acidic environment of the stomach by producing enzymes that neutralize acid. This bacterium can damage the protective mucous layer that shields the stomach wall from digestive juices. Once this barrier is weakened, stomach acid can irritate and erode the underlying tissue, leading to the formation of an ulcer.

The transmission of H. pylori is not fully understood, but it is believed to spread from person to person through direct contact with saliva, vomit, or fecal matter. Contaminated food or water is also a potential route of infection. Many people infected with H. pylori never develop ulcers or other symptoms, suggesting that other factors, such as genetics or lifestyle, may play a role in whether the infection leads to ulcer disease.

Nonsteroidal Anti-Inflammatory Drugs (NSAIDs)

Another major cause of stomach ulcers is the regular use of NSAIDs. These medications, which include common over-the-counter drugs like ibuprofen (Advil, Motrin), naproxen (Aleve), and aspirin, as well as prescription NSAIDs, are widely used to relieve pain, reduce inflammation, and lower fever. However, NSAIDs work by inhibiting enzymes called cyclooxygenases (COX), which are involved in producing prostaglandins. Prostaglandins play a vital role in protecting the stomach lining by increasing blood flow to the stomach wall and stimulating the production of protective mucus and bicarbonate.

When NSAIDs block these prostaglandins, the stomach's natural defense mechanisms are compromised. This makes the stomach lining more vulnerable to damage from stomach acid. The risk of developing an ulcer from NSAID use increases with higher doses, longer duration of use, and in individuals who are older or have a history of ulcers. It is important to note that even occasional use of NSAIDs can cause problems for some individuals, especially those with existing risk factors.

How Ulcers Develop

The stomach is naturally equipped with a protective lining made of mucus. This mucus layer acts as a barrier, preventing the strong digestive acids and enzymes in the stomach from breaking down the stomach tissue itself. When this protective barrier is weakened or damaged by H. pylori or NSAIDs, the stomach acid can begin to corrode the stomach wall. This leads to inflammation and the formation of an open sore, or ulcer.

The symptoms of stomach ulcers can vary but often include a burning stomach pain, which may be worse when the stomach is empty and improve after eating or taking antacids. Other symptoms can include bloating, nausea, vomiting, loss of appetite, and unexplained weight loss. If left untreated, ulcers can lead to serious complications such as bleeding, perforation (a hole through the stomach wall), or obstruction.

Diagnosis and Treatment

Diagnosing stomach ulcers typically involves a physical examination, a review of medical history, and diagnostic tests. These tests may include endoscopy (a procedure where a flexible tube with a camera is inserted into the stomach to visualize the lining), tests for H. pylori infection (such as breath, stool, or blood tests), and sometimes imaging studies like X-rays.

Treatment for stomach ulcers aims to relieve pain, promote healing, and address the underlying cause. For H. pylori-related ulcers, treatment usually involves a combination of antibiotics to eradicate the bacteria and medications to reduce stomach acid production (proton pump inhibitors or H2 blockers). For NSAID-induced ulcers, the primary step is to stop or reduce the use of the offending NSAID, along with acid-reducing medications. Lifestyle modifications, such as quitting smoking, limiting alcohol intake, and managing stress, can also support the healing process and prevent recurrence.
